Transaction 08588704d9fb09b151d803ed8d0365ab0993652da4c86d21559ac0a81397118c
1 Input
1 Output
-
08588704d9fb09b151d803ed8d0365ab0993652da4c86d21559ac0a81397118c:0
- value
- 878862
- script pubkey
- OP_0 OP_PUSHBYTES_20 4353f2cf75d1e379d8be660c767d8ccb8730be53
- address
- bc1qgdfl9nm4683hnk97vcx8vlvvewrnp0jntwn4wc